Xel-Ha awarded new acknowledgement for its exemplary waste management
Posted by: dvillacis in Awards and acknowledgementsFor the second time in 2008, Xel-Ha Natural Wonder was awarded a national acknowledgment for its ongoing labour at the “Waste Recollection and Transfer Centre”, in which over 400 tons of waste matter is gathered and separated yearly; the Mexican Philanthropy Centre will deliver the prize to the Best Company Practices in the “Integral Management of Solid Wastes” category.
During the event, that will be held September 8th in Guadalajara, several corporate practices will be acknowledged, which, as Xel-Ha’s, contribute to caring for the environment and are worthy examples on a national level: “Recycling and Treatment for Residual Waters”, by Colgate Palmolive; “Residual Co-processing” by CeMex; “Alternative Energy Recycling Program for Ecosystem Conservation”, by Cementos Cruz Azul; as well as “Sustainable management for spent tyres”, by Holcim Apasco, amongst several others.
The “Waste Recollection and Transfer Centre” in Xel-Ha has evolved from 1999 into a full-fledged program that separates and manages waste generated daily as a product of tourist activity. Careful and timely classification of waste products has allowed an average recycling volume of 70% of total generated waste.
From 1999 to 2007, over 1017 tons of organic material have been recovered, 104 tons of paper and cardboard, and over 16 tons of metal. This activity on behalf of any tourist company is fundamental, due to the fact that it avoids the saturation of sanitary landfills and extends the lifespan of both landfills and the surrounding environment.
Besides, WRTC functions as a educational role model for schools, organisations, and individuals interested in having a closer look at this experience. This project is in constant stages of improvement, thanks to the ISO14001 system’s implementation. Barely days ago, on July 5th, Xel-Ha received the National Acknowledgement to Residue Recycling, granted by the SEMARNAT and Coparmex. Xel-Ha has been awarded the 100 Greatest Places to Work in Mexico acknowledgement as well, continuously for the past 5 years, and has been certified as a Socially Responsible Company for the 7th consecutive year.
The Mexican Centre for Philanthropy (CeMeFi), is a non-profit association founded in December 1988, as a private institution without ties to any political parties or religious or racial groups. Over 630 persons are members of the CeMeFi, including representatives from several benefit organisations, government secretariats, and international institutions. Their goal is to endorse and systematically acknowledge philanthropic, committed, and socially responsible participation on behalf of citizens and diverse organisations, in an aim to achieve a more supportive, just, and prosperous society.
